As Bitcoin dipped below $80,000 following a peak of $81,280, strong fund inflows and the upcoming Fed message have taken center stage in the market.
Bitcoin traded just below the $80,000 level during Asian trading hours. According to CoinDesk data, the price has risen approximately 2% over the last 24 hours, pulling back after hitting $81,280 overnight. Markets are awaiting U.S. Federal Reserve Chair Kevin Warsh’s first Jackson Hole speech later today.
The annual meeting held in Wyoming is monitored as one of the key events where Fed chairs deliver important messages regarding interest rate policy. Warsh’s speech could provide the first comprehensive signals regarding the direction of rates ahead of the Fed meeting on September 16.

$2.8 Billion Injected into Bitcoin Funds in Eight Sessions
Bitcoin moved from $64,723 to $79,345.2 over the last 30-day period, a gain of 22.6 percent.

In the U.S., exchange-traded funds that directly track the price of Bitcoin—specifically spot Bitcoin ETFs—attracted $2.8 billion in investment over eight consecutive sessions. Total inflows in August have exceeded $3 billion, approaching the strongest month of 2026 so far.
While fund purchases continue, interest rate expectations are exerting pressure in the opposite direction. Futures markets are pricing in a 35% probability of a rate hike in September, while expectations for a hike by December are fully priced in. Bitcoin, meanwhile, has gained approximately 9% over the past week.
Among altcoins, Solana rose approximately 4% daily to approach $101, bringing its weekly gains to 20%. Ethereum gained just over 1%, while XRP rose by over 2%. Warsh’s message will be closely watched to see if Bitcoin can maintain its position around $80,000 despite strong fund demand.
